Pairing for Perfection and Ensuring Readability
A font rarely works in complete isolation. The true skill in typography lies in pairing. December Script, as a display-oriented handwritten font, demands a partner that provides balance and clarity. The general rule of thumb is to pair a decorative script with a clean, simple sans serif font or a classic, readable serif font.
For a modern, approachable look, try pairing it with a geometric sans serif like Montserrat or Lato for body text. The clean lines will provide a perfect counterpoint to the script’s fluidity, ensuring your main content remains highly readable. For a more traditional or elegant feel, a transitional serif like Garamond or Baskerville can create a beautiful, timeless combination. The key is contrast: let December Script be the star for headlines, logos, and special phrases, while its partner handles the heavy lifting of paragraphs and longer text.
Readability is paramount. A script font, no matter how beautiful, is not designed for lengthy body copy. Its intricate letterforms can cause eye strain over long passages. Use it strategically for short bursts of text where its personality can shine without compromising the user experience. Always test your pairings at different sizes and on various devices to ensure legibility remains consistent across your web design and print projects.
